The House of the Seven Gables is a 1940 Gothic drama film based on the 1851 novel of the same name by Nathaniel Hawthorne. It stars George Sanders, Margaret Lindsay, and Vincent Price, and tells the story of a family consumed by greed in which one brother frames another for murder.

Miss Emmerton purchased the house in 1911 when it demolition became a threat. She had it moved from Washington Street in Salem to its present location. Though the home was restored in the Colonial Revival style, it still retains a number of Jacobean details including an exterior overhang girt and specially preserved plaster treatments in the great hall. It was built c.1655 by John Beckett, the first in a long line of famed Salem shipbuilders.

Three generations of Turners lived in the home, increasing its size and the family’s wealth, until John Turner III lost everything and the house was sold to another mariner, Samuel Ingersoll, in 1782. Upon Ingersoll’s death, daughter Susanna inherited the great mansion, where she was often visited by her younger cousin, Nathaniel Hawthorne. Although Hawthorne claims in his preface that The House of the Seven Gables is not based on any location. However, the Turner House, or Turner-Ingersoll Mansion, in Salem, Massachusetts, was an inspiration for him. The Ingersolls were Hawthorne’s cousins, and he was struck by the house’s history (though, having been renovated to match popular trends, it only boasted three gables at that time). The mansion is a museum today, and citizenship and ESL classes are also offered there.

Whether big or small, houses require ongoing maintenance and occasional repairs when something wears out or goes wrong. The good news is that maintenance and repair costs on a tiny home are a fraction of what they would be for a conventional full-size home. For instance, the cost to paint a house is about $0.50 to $4 per square foot, which translates to over $3,000 for a traditional house, but it will be much lower for a tiny house. Tiny-house owners can expect to pay between $550 and $1,000 annually on repairs.

If you have intentions of selling your tiny house down the road, do not expect to get what you paid for it. But if you have no intentions of parting ways with your tiny house, its status in the real estate market won’t affect you. Because tiny houses are a very niche market, there are fewer interested buyers looking for tiny houses. This means that tiny houses are more difficult to sell than regular sized houses. While the ticket prices of tiny houses are less than traditional houses, the return on investment is generally not as good.

Mable House Barnes Amphitheatre is the result of former Governor Roy Barnes' goal to provide Mableton with a quality outdoor theatre. Shortly after his election in 2000, he contacted the Cobb Board of Commissioners and asked that a program for such a facility be developed. This was quickly done and Governor Barnes, with the support of the local legislative delegation, provided a state grant for construction.
